Axborot xavfsizligi” kafedrasi 5330300-Axborot xavfsizligi



Yüklə 72,5 Kb.
səhifə4/5
tarix06.06.2023
ölçüsü72,5 Kb.
#125675
1   2   3   4   5
ga

2.3.OTA-ONALARNI TANLASH
Genetik algoritmlarda Genetik algoritmlarda ko'payish nasl berish uchun bir nechta ota-onalarni, odatda ikkitasini talab qiladi.
Ota-onalarni tanlashning bir nechta usullari mavjud:

  1. Panmiksiya - ikkala ota-ona ham tasodifiy tanlanadi, aholining har bir shaxsi tanlanish uchun teng imkoniyatga ega.

  2. Inbreeding - birinchi ota-ona tasodifiy tanlanadi, ikkinchisi esa birinchi ota-onaga eng o'xshashi tanlanadi.

  3. Outbreeding - birinchi ota-ona tasodifiy tanlanadi, ikkinchisi esa birinchi ota-onaga eng kam o'xshash bo'ladi.

Inbreeding va outbreding ikki shaklda bo'ladi: fenotipik va genotipik. Fenotipik shaklda o'xshashlik moslik funktsiyasi qiymatiga qarab o'lchanadi (moslik funksiyasi qiymatlari qanchalik yaqin bo'lsa, shaxslar shunchalik o'xshash bo'ladi), genotipik shaklda esa moslik genotipning namoyon bo'lishiga qarab (individlar genotiplari orasidagi farqlar qanchalik kam bo'lsa, individlar shunchalik o'xshash bo'ladi).


2.4.KO'PAYISH(CHATISHUV)
Turli xil algoritmlarda ko'payish turli yo'llar bilan aniqlanadi-bu, albatta, ma'lumotlarning taqdimotiga bog'liq. Chatishuvning asosiy talabi shundaki, nasl yoki avlodlar ikkala ota-onaning xususiyatlarini qandaydir tarzda "aralashtirish" orqali meros qilib olishlari.

Nima uchun ko'payish uchun shaxslar odatda H' elementlarining birinchi bosqichida tanlanib olganlaridan emas, balki butun H populyatsiyasidan tanlanadi? Haqiqat shundaki, ko'plab genetik algoritmlarning asosiy kamchiliklari odamlarda xilma — xillikning yo'qligi. Mahalliy maksimal bo'lgan bitta genotip tezda ajralib chiqadi, so'ngra populyatsiyaning barcha elementlari seleksiyani yo'qotadi va butun populyatsiya ushbu shaxsning nusxalari bilan "ko'payadi". Bunday yondashuv bilan genotipning xilma-xilligi uchun mutatsiyalarning roli oshadi.




2.5.MUTATSIYALAR
Xuddi shu narsa ko'payish mutatsiyalariga ham tegishli: genetik algoritmning parametri bo'lgan mutantlarning μ ning ma'lum bir qismi mavjud va mutatsiya bosqichida siz μN shaxslarni tanlashingiz va keyin ularni oldindan belgilangan mutatsiya operatsiyalariga muvofiq o'zgartirishingiz kerak.

Yüklə 72,5 Kb.

Dostları ilə paylaş:
1   2   3   4   5




Verilənlər bazası müəlliflik hüququ ilə müdafiə olunur ©www.azkurs.org 2024
rəhbərliyinə müraciət

gir | qeydiyyatdan keç
    Ana səhifə


yükləyin